Joseph Kilonzo
In primary school I was used to being sent for school fees, sometimes we skipped lunch and ate during supper.
When I was sent for school fees as I was preparing for KCPE, I felt really bad. From that I learnt the life we live has ups and downs
When I did my KCPE and scored 375 and I felt really proud and happy.
The most memorable and happiest thing in my life is the transition from primary school to secondary.
My dream is to become a doctor and I am going to study harder to score an A.
When I become a doctor, I will improve the living standards of my family and also build a hospital to also help my community. I will thank WEF for helping to fund them in their good project.
I will try to fight corruption, improve the quality of health of people living in my community and make my environment clean.
